Your new company You will be working for a market-leading industrial supply business based in Warwick. They are experiencing a period of growth and require an experienced demand planner to come on board and help develop the standard operating practices.

Your new role In this role you will maximise demand planning by creating accurate demand plans using historical sales data to ensure timely and complete deliveries from key suppliers. Purchase stock and supplies per SOPs, maintain effective supplier communication, monitor shipments, and resolve issues promptly. Set up new parts according to SOPs, conduct regular audits to maintain data integrity, and correct discrepancies. Report on KPIs, implement actions to address performance deviations, and engage colleagues in maximising ERP system use to meet customer needs. Monitor supplier OTIF performance, provide relevant data for reviews, and resolve supplier issues promptly. Contribute to company success by supporting and participating in projects like process improvements to enhance supply chain efficiency and reduce lead times.

What you'll need to succeed To be successful in this role you will need a minimum of 1 year's experience in demand planning as well as experience in production forecasting, ERP/MRP systems and highly skilled with Excel. The role requirements are based around five key performance competencies- Planning and organisation, using initiative, work quality, customer responsiveness and communication. The ability to demonstrate examples of these indicators will be advantageous. This role will require someone who is a self-starter and can work autonomously.

What you'll get in return For this role you will receive a permanent contract alongside an annual salary of up to £40,000 DOE. The role is based on site in Warwick, 08:30am to 17:00pm Monday to Friday. There is some consideration for limited home working such as 1 day a week.
